> i thought u cant meter with a 87c in front because it is opaque?

Depends upon the spectral sensitivity of the meter, which is determined
by cell type, internal filtering, and internal electronics.  Just
because you can't see through an 87C doesn't necessarily mean that your
meter can't.  For those with this question, why not call the technical
service department of the manufacturer of your camera and/or meter and
find out for sure?
